Transaction eca58315fe0b7e2b94331ae02e2bbcd2f2c856a9c958a750988180b695e5349a
1 Input
1 Output
-
eca58315fe0b7e2b94331ae02e2bbcd2f2c856a9c958a750988180b695e5349a:0
- value
- 3039046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0fe23bb267f7b14543a06ae297876059cae0c7e OP_EQUAL
- address
- 3PfGYWYjhdoCFqqvHgP2LJShLeWdtcFx8P